2024年1月6日发(作者:)
iframe用法详解
关于iframe的使用方法的详解。
一、什么是iframe?
IFrame是HTML中的一种元素或标签,即“嵌套式框架”(Inline
Frame)的缩写。它允许将另一个HTML文档嵌入到当前文档中的一个窗口或框架中。
二、iframe的基本语法和属性介绍
- src:指定要嵌入的HTML文档的URL。
- width和height:设置iframe的宽度和高度。
- frameborder:设置边框的宽度,默认值为0。
- scrolling:设置是否显示滚动条,可选值为"yes"、"no"和"auto"。
- allowfullscreen:指定是否允许全屏显示嵌入内容。
三、如何在页面中插入一个iframe?
1. 在HTML文件中的合适位置添加
2. 使用src属性来指定要嵌入的HTML文档的URL。
3. 根据需要设置宽度、高度、边框样式以及是否显示滚动条等属性。
四、iframe的使用场景
1. 页面内嵌其他网页内容:通过iframe,可以将其他网页的内容嵌入到当前页面中,实现页面的模块化设计。
2. 展示嵌入式视频:通过将视频链接嵌入到iframe中,可以在网页中直接播放视频而无需跳转到其他页面。
3. 加载广告或第三方内容:通过将广告代码或第三方内容的URL嵌入到iframe中,可以在页面中显示广告或外部内容。
4. 分割页面布局:通过将不同的HTML文档放置于不同的iframe中,可以实现复杂的页面布局。
五、常见的iframe使用问题及解决方法
1. 造成页面布局错乱:如果iframe的尺寸没有设置好,可能会导致页面布局错乱。可以通过设置iframe的宽度和高度来解决。
2. 安全性问题:使用iframe时要注意确保嵌入的网页是可信的,以防止恶意代码执行。可以限制嵌入网页的域名或使用沙箱(Sandbox)技术进行安全隔离。
3. 无法与嵌入内容进行交互:如果嵌入的网页属于不同的域名,可能会出现跨域访问的问题。解决方法可以是使用postMessage方法进行跨窗口通信。
4. SEO问题:如果页面中大部分内容是通过iframe加载的,可能会影响搜索引擎对页面的收录。解决方法可以是在iframe中添加description等元信息,或者通过使用服务器端渲染等技术。
六、总结
iframe是一种在HTML中嵌套其他网页内容的强大标签,能够实现对不同源的内容进行引用、展示和交互。合理使用iframe可以提升页面的灵活性和交互性,但需要注意安全性、SEO等问题。通过理解iframe的基本语法和属性,掌握其常见的使用场景和解决方法,我们可以更加灵活地运用iframe来构建丰富多样的网页。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1704516698a1355545.html
评论列表(0条)